Hi Dan,

Your code works for me but requires that the sheet holding the code
recalculate.

It might suit your purposes better if you were to use the Worksheet_Change
event. Try putting the following into the Hospital sheet's code module:

Private Sub Worksheet_Change(ByVal Target As Range)
Worksheets("Interview").Rows(9).Hidden = _
UCase(Me.Range("B5").Value) = "NO"
End Sub
